Slide 4
Wear depends on:
• Slurry particle size distribution
• Particle hardness and shape
• Particle concentration
• Velocity
• Doubling velocity increases wear-rate 4-6 times
• Settling slurries, bed loads
• Impingement angle
• Excessive wear on elbows, reducers, etc.
• Other factors:

Slide 6
• 2 wear reducing philosophies
• A) “The harder the solids in the slurry and the harder the internal pipe
surface, the less the wear.”
• Material alloying, e.g. by increasing C- and Mn-content
• Steel hardening, e.g. induction heating
• Wear tiles, e.g. cemented carbides
• Double wall pipes
• Bimetallic pipes, e.g. weld overlays
• B) “The harder the solids in the slurry and the more elastic the
internal pipe surface, the less the wear.”
• PE liners
• Rubber liners
• Polyurethane liners
• High-Performance Elastomer Liners

Slide 7
• Both philosophies are justified, depending on the conditions of the
application.
A) Metallic Solutions:
1. High to very high cost
2. Lifetime increase in comparison to mild steel:
• Material alloying, e.g. AR200 piping 1.5 to 2 times
• Induction heating, 3 to 8 times
• Wear tiles, 5 to 10 times
• Weld overlays, 6 to 20 times
B) Polymer Liner Solutions:
1. Moderate cost
2. Lifetime increase 5 to 20 times

Slide 8
B) Polymer Liner Solutions:
HDPE liners are used in some long-distance slurry pipelines where abrasion
is less of an issue („rounded“ particles after first few km)
Advantages:
• Low cost material
• Relatively easy installation, no pipe preparation required
Disadvantages:
• If components of the stream can penetrate the liner (e.g., dissolved
gases), these will accumulate between liner and steel pipe wall.
• back pressure can result in liner collapse
• if these components are corrosive, steel wall corrosion can occur
• HDPE is not very abrasion resistant
• HDPE liners are not chemically bound to the pipe wall liner thickness is
dependent on pipe diameter to provide mechanical stability

Slide 9
B) Polymer Liner Solutions:
Rubber or Polyurethane (PUR) liners (technically: coatings) are applied
where high wear occurs, e.g., station piping, tailings, high turbulence areas.
Advantages:
• Material is chemically bound to the pipe wall, no danger of liner collapse
• High abrasion resistance
• High degree of freedom with respect to geometry; almost every pipe
component can be coated
• In lower wear applications, a much lower material thickness can be used
than with HDPE liner which evens out the higher material price
Disadvantages:
• More expensive per kg than HDPE liners
• Field joining often requires flanges or re-coating of weld areas
• Factory applied
• In case of standard PUR: sometimes insufficient adhesion to steel

Slide 22
DESIGN LIFE - - EXPERIENCE IN THE FIELD
From field trial experience with 1” coating thickness and an i.d. of 30” in oil
sands tailings for over 3 years, it can be concluded that life time of steel pipes
coated with High Performance Polyurethane Elastomers exceeds that of carbon
steel by a factor of approx. 8-10. This translates into approx. 20’000 to 25’000
hours of operation without rotation in a tailings line where carbon steel pipes
need to be rotated every 2’500 to 3’000 hours.
High Performance Polyurethane Elastomer Coatings are now commercially
applied in a number of oil sands tailings and hydrotransport lines; predominantly
in the coating thickness range of 1” up to 2” on pipes of nominal inner diameter
in the 28” to 36” range.

Slide 24
DESIGN LIFE - - EXPERIENCE IN THE FIELD
Water Injection Lines for Enhanced Oil Recovery
In a trial for water injection for
EOR, a 5 mm coating was applied
due to the smaller (12”) pipe
diameter. The pipes in question
usually contain chromium carbide
overlays (CCO) for abrasion
protection.
In the trial, High Performance
Polyurethane Elastomer coating
lasted as long as the overlay; an
end point has not yet been
determined.

Slide 25
DESIGN LIFE - - EXPERIENCE IN THE FIELD
Erosion-Corrosion in Oil Sands Tailings
In an oil sands tailings line, a high
turbulence area was chosen for a field test
of High Performance PUR Elastomer
coating. In this location, steel pipe with
CCO pipe needs to be rotated every 2’500
to 3’000 hours of operation
Although in tests ASTM G75 and ASTM B
611, CCO shows a significantly lower wear
than High Performance PUR Elastomers,
in this field trial, the Elastomer has reached
4’000 hours of operation without rotation at
the time of this presentation. The most
likely explanation is erosion-corrosion of
the CCO. Further investigation is under
way.
The effect of erosion-corrosion
often is stronger than the sum of
both effects taken separately.
Microscopic erosive damage of the
steel surface can provide an attack
point promoting fast corrosion.

Slide 28
OUTLOOK AND FURTHER APPLICATIONS
Low-erosion slurry lines / erosion-corrosion conditions
As mentioned under 1., for conditions of mild wear and / or potential of
erosion-corrosion, often HDPE liners are used. E.g., for long-distance
slurry transport.
• For an 18“ steel pipe ID, minimum structural thickness of an HDPE liner
has to be 13 mm.
• For the same pipe ID, a High Performance PUR Elastomer coating thickness of
3 mm is sufficient.
Material cost similar or lower than with HDPE liner
Installation cost lower due to field welding process
Higher safety against penetration of erosive components
Higher wear resistance – longer design life
